The microstructure and hardness of copper alloy after fatigue-creep interaction
testing have been investigated. Experiments were carried out in the temperature
range from room temperature to 300oC. Attention has been paid to the role of the
microstructure and hardness on the fatigue-creep strength of copper alloy. It has
been shown that, there is a little effect of microstructure in the cyclic response of
copper alloy, while the hardness has a significant effect on the fatigue-creep
strength. The relation between strength and hardness were described by the
following equation:
σE.L. = 5.345 H0.6217
